Competitive benefits including 401k match and Incentive Bonus How you will make an impact: You will lead all plant
  • level accounting, financial reporting and analysis activities to support strategic business decision-making and will be a key business partner to plant leadership and VP of Manufacturing with accountability for financial performance, compliance and continuous improvement activities.
What You'll Do:
Lead all plant accounting and financial reporting activities with accuracy, timeliness and compliance with corporate and regulatory guidance Own the monthly close process including journal entries, reconciliation and variance analysis Prepare and analyze financial results including P&L variances to forecast, budget and prior year, communicating insights to management Coordinate annual budget and periodic forecasts and serve as a key contributor to strategic and capital planning activities Partner with plant and operations leadership to evaluate productivity, cost reduction and working capital initiatives Lead capital expenditure, inventory and cost accounting activities Continuously improve processes and coach and develop finance staff
What You Bring:
Bachelor's degree in finance or accounting required; CPA and/or MBA preferred 7+ years of progressive accounting or finance experience in a manufacturing environment including cost accounting and financial reporting Demonstrated experience with budgeting, forecasting, inventory valuation and capital analysis Strong working knowledge of internal controls and financial compliance requirements Proven ability to analyze complex financial data and translate it into actionable business insights Experience partnering with operations or manufacturing leadership is preferred Proficiency with ERP and financial reporting systems; Microsoft Dynamics and Essbase experience a plus Advance skills in Microsoft Excel and related financial tools Strong communication and leadership skills Lakeside Book Company•
